Air Fryer Honey Soy Salmon Bites

Ingredients

500g salmon fillets, skin removed

2 tbsp soy sauce

1 tbsp honey

1 tsp garlic powder

1 tsp sesame oil

1 tbsp sesame seeds

Spring onions to serve

Method

Cut salmon into bite-sized cubes.

Mix soy sauce, honey, garlic powder and sesame oil.

Toss salmon through marinade.

Place in air fryer basket and cook at 200C for 8-10 minutes.

Sprinkle with sesame seeds and spring onions before serving.

TIP

Pat the salmon dry before marinating. It helps the glaze cling better and gives you those beautiful caramelised edges everyone loves.
